General Information
Tour Route: Ereen Khot - Zamiin Uud - Sainshand Town - Tsonjin Boldog - Terelj National Park - Ulaanbaatar Capital - Erdenet City - Lake Khuvsgul - Tosontsengel - Oyu Tolgoi - Ulgii Town - Khovd Town - Gobi Altai - Uvurkhangai - Khara Khorum - Ulaanbaatar Capital - Ereen Khot - Zamiin Uud
Duration: 22 Days/ 21 Nights
Start/ End: Ereen Khot - Zamiin Uud/ Zamiin Uud - Ereen Khot
Guides: Local Guide (English Speaking Guide, Other Languages upon Request)
